Meditation and Yoga Helped J Achieve Her First Birth Center Birth

  • When did you realize you were really in labor?

    7:30 Tuesday morning, contractions were 7 min apart

  • What was the most challenging thing about going natural?

    The waiting, for contractions to speed up and not knowing when it was going to end.

  • What was the most helpful thing you did to prepare for childbirth?

    Mediation in third trimester and yoga

  • What surprised you about your birth?

    The pushing was the easy part, after 48 hours of contractions!

  • What pain relief strategies worked best?

    Having a doula to help me into different positions and keep me calm, all fours leaning on the back of the bed was best!
    Also the birthing tub and showering helped a lot!

  • What position did you end up delivering in?

    In the tub on back

  • How did it feel to hold your baby for the first time?

    The most amazing feeling ever, the pain of labor and delivery went out the door, I immediately forgot about it and all that mattered was him!

  • What advice can you give to other mamas who want to go natural?

    You CAN do it, it's scary only because you don't know what to expect or how you'll handle it, but if you do your research and prepare you will feel more comfortable. Have a good support system, my fiance and doula stuck it out with me and it was a long labor, without them I wouldn't have been able to do it!
    I always thought the alternative to natural birth was much scarier, so it wasn't an option for me, I wanted to be in control and wanted to be able to move around and be comfortable (as comfortable as possible!)
